Understanding Turbochargers
A turbocharger is a device that forces more air into the engine, allowing it to burn more fuel and produce more power. The K04 and GTX2867R are two popular turbo options for the GTI, each offering different performance characteristics.
K04 Turbocharger Overview
The K04 turbocharger is an OEM upgrade option that provides a noticeable increase in power over the stock turbo. It is designed to fit directly onto the GTI’s existing setup without major modifications.

GTX2867R Turbocharger Overview
The GTX2867R is a part of the Garrett GTX series, known for its advanced technology and efficiency. This turbo is capable of supporting much higher power levels compared to the K04.

Comparing Power Outputs
When considering a 700hp upgrade, the choice between the K04 and GTX2867R will significantly impact the performance. The GTX2867R is more suited for achieving higher horsepower due to its larger size and efficiency.
Achieving 700hp with GTX2867R
To achieve 700hp with the GTX2867R, additional modifications are typically required, including:
- Upgraded fuel system
- High-performance intercooler
- Custom tuning
- Stronger internal engine components
Limitations of the K04 Turbo
The K04 turbo may struggle to reach 700hp without extensive modifications, which can lead to reliability issues. It is generally recommended for those looking for a balanced performance upgrade rather than extreme horsepower.
